The only Fathom Green 69 Yenko Camaro with black stripes that I know of is N663482. I believe that car was from the Pittsburg area. It was restored in the mid 90's and owned by Brian Henderson at one time. I've never seen it in person and don't know its whereabouts today.

From the information I have there were three other Fathom Green Camaros sold out of Yenko in '69, but only one of those is a known car. It was owned by Vickie Koss in the late 80's and was restored. There was also one sold in Youngstown OH that is a known car. It was restored by Randy Miller in the mid 90's. I don't know if either of those cars was in the Pittsburg area in the mid 80's or not.
